School Supply List for Sunnyside Elementry in Minot ND

Hopefully you did NOT miss orientation day yesterday at Sunnyside School but if you did and if you missed the supply lists posted at Kmart and Walmart here it is. Please pardon the highlighted items as those were what we needed personally for our own Sunnyside student, Timmothy.
The flood that destroyed the river vally of Minot was particularly hard on several elementary schools. School has been post-poned a week and is scheduled to start on Tuesday September 6th. Many think that another postponement is inevitable. Some schools were totally destroyed and are meeting in temporary classrooms. Word has it that some have no desks, chairs, teaching materials and so on. It's going to be interesting.
I can only encourage you to keep checking the Minot Public Schools website for more information.
